Emergency food distribution to continue until March - Zimbabwe Situation

Summary by Zimbabwe Situation
Source: The Herald – Breaking news. Minister Richard Moyo Leonard Ncube, Victoria Falls Bureau The rains being experienced across the country have sparked optimism for a successful farming season, with the hope that the food distribution under the drought mitigation programme will continue until March, when the first harvests come in to support vulnerable communities. The programme, launched last year in response to the El Niño-induced drought…
